30 sites located near a little creek that feeds Sugar Pine Reservoir.
Gorgeous scenery, calm, and relaxing. Swim in the lake or hike on the trail that surrounds it. Set up camp right on a picturesque creek and fall asleep to the sound of running water. Wake up early and take a walk in the brisk morning air to the reservoir where you can swim out to a small island.

From Interstate 80: Take the Foresthill Road exit for 17 miles to the town of Foresthill. Continue on the road for 9 miles to Sugar Pine Road. Turn left and continue on Sugar Pine Road for 9 miles and take a right on the first road after the Sugar Pine Recreation Area sign. Travel 1 1/2 miles to the campground.
